Visual Information Specialist

U.S. Census Bureau · Suitland, Maryland
Federal transitionOpen to the publicTelework eligible

What you'd do

This vacancy is for a Visual Information Specialist position in the Associate Director for Communications located at the U.S. Census Bureau Headquarters in Suitland, Maryland. The Census Bureau is accessible from the Metro Rail Green Line - Suitland Station. This Job Opportunity Announcement may be used to fill other Visual Information Specialist, 1084-9/11/12, FPL GS-12 positions within the Census Bureau in the same geographical location with the same qualifications and specialized experience.

Major duties

Designs and creates economic and statistical content for accuracy, clarity, and accessibility for multiple audiences. Creates materials including graphics, flyers, social media graphics charts, tables, and visuals for different platforms according to related policies and standards. Ensures content and format are appropriate for target audience. Collaborates to create and improve content, following best practices, working on multiple projects and meeting deadlines.

To qualify for the position of Visual Information Specialist, at GS-1084-9/11/12, you must meet the minimum and/or basic qualification requirements listed below. BASIC QUALIFICATIONS: Minimum Education Requirement: Undergraduate or Graduate Education: Major study -- commercial art, fine arts, art history, industrial design, architecture, drafting, interior design, photography, visual communication, or other field related to the position. -- OR -- Specialized Experience: Experience in the actual type of work for which application is made. Unpaid experience is creditable, provided the work done was of a quality level and demonstrated the ability required for the position. This includes planning the preparation and use of photographs, illustrations, drawings, and other art work, charts, diagrams, dioramas, maps, slides, overlays, and other kinds of visual material for use in communicating information through visual means. M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: FOR THE GS-09: You must have one year of experience at a level of difficulty and responsibility equivalent to the GS-07 in the Federal service. Experience for this position includes: assisting in the development of visual communication products; using design software; Applying branding, formatting, or style guidelines; preparing design files for review; AND supporting multiple design projects. -- OR -- Education: 2 years of progressively higher-level graduate education leading to a master's degree or master's or equivalent graduate degree -- OR -- Combination of Education and Experience: A combination of specialized experience and graduate-level education that, when combined, meets 100% of the qualification requirements for this position. Only graduate education in excess of the amount required for the next lower grade level may be used in combination. Applicants qualifying based on education must submit transcripts. FOR THE GS-11: You must have one year of experience at a level of difficulty and responsibility equivalent to the GS-09 in the Federal service. Experience for this position includes: developing graphic materials for a variety of platforms; using professional design tools; Translating complex or data-heavy information; applying visual information techniques; AND managing multiple design projects simultaneously. -- OR -- Education: 3 years of progressively higher-level graduate education leading to a Ph.D. degree or Ph.D. or equivalent doctoral degree -- OR -- Combination of Education and Experience: A combination of specialized experience and graduate-level education that, when combined, meets 100% of the qualification requirements for this position. Only graduate education in excess of the amount required for the next lower grade level may be used in combination. Applicants qualifying based on education must submit transcripts.??????? FOR THE GS-12: You must have one year of experience at a level of difficulty and responsibility equivalent to the GS-11 in the Federal service. Experience for this position includes: designing and producing high-visibility visual communication products; accurately depicting complex statistical or economic concepts; leading or coordinating design projects; providing technical guidance or informal leadership; ensuring compliance with accessibility requirements; AND working directly with internal clients and program areas. -- OR -- Education: Education cannot be substituted for experience at this grade level. Experience refers to paid and unpaid experience, including volunteer work done through National Service programs (e.g., Peace Corps, AmeriCorps) and other organizations (e.g., professional; philanthropic; religious; spiritual; community, student, social). Volunteer work helps build critical competencies, knowledge, and skills and can provide valuable training and experience that translates directly to paid employment.
